数据通信方法、系统、装置以及存储介质制造方法及图纸

技术编号:30647395 阅读:18 留言:0更新日期:2021-11-04 00:58
本申请涉及应用于第三方系统与用户端之间的数据通信方法、系统、装置以及存储介质,涉及数据通信技术领域,其包括接入并获取第三方系统用户的数据参数;将所述数据参数录入至用户信息数据库并与用户信息数据库内预存的用户信息数据进行匹配;基于安全平台检测第三方系统用户的数据参数安全性;调用并封装第三方系统的原生接口;获取企业应用集成平台内的应用构件,并将应用构件发布至第三方系统中;利用第三方系统的原生接口和所述应用构件组建移动端应用功能模块;基于移动端应用功能模块获取集成第三方系统的消息并发送。本申请具有数据通信稳定性高的效果。数据通信稳定性高的效果。数据通信稳定性高的效果。

【技术实现步骤摘要】
数据通信方法、系统、装置以及存储介质


[0001]本申请涉及数据通信
,尤其是涉及应用于第三方系统与用户端之间的数据通信方法、系统、装置以及存储介质。

技术介绍

[0002]消息中间件是指支持与保障分布式应用程序之间同步/异步收发消息的中间件。消息中间件是一种独立的系统软件或服务程序,它在计算机系统中是一个关键软件,位于用户应用和操作系统及网络软件之间,为应用提供了公用的通信手段,并且独立于网络和操作系统。消息中间件为开发者提供了公用于所有环境的应用程序接口,当应用程序中嵌入其函数调用,它便可利用其运行的特定操作系统和网络环境的功能,为应用执行通信功能。
[0003]为了满足企业一点应用多点发布的移动端诉求,避免信息孤岛,中间件得到了广泛的使用,中间件能够应对快速增长的移动端需求,因此如何提高中间件与移动端通信的稳定性,亟待改进。

技术实现思路

[0004]为了改善提高中间件与移动端通信的稳定性,本申请提供应用于第三方系统与用户端之间的数据通信方法、系统、装置以及存储介质。
[0005]第一方面,本申请提供的应用于第三方系统与用户端之间的数据通信方法采用如下的技术方案:应用于第三方系统与用户端之间的数据通信方法,包括以下步骤:接入并获取第三方系统用户的数据参数;将所述数据参数录入至用户信息数据库并与用户信息数据库内预存的用户信息数据进行匹配;基于安全平台检测第三方系统用户的数据参数安全性;调用并封装第三方系统的原生接口;获取企业应用集成平台内的应用构件,并将应用构件发布至第三方系统中;利用第三方系统的原生接口和所述应用构件组建移动端应用功能模块;基于移动端应用功能模块获取集成第三方系统的消息。
[0006]通过采用上述技术方案,先获取第三方系统的用户信息并进行匹配判断用户信息的安全,以提高用户信息的安全性,并通过第三方系统的远程接口和应用构件共同组建移动端应用功能模块,提高了数据通信的快捷性和稳定性,并基于移动端应用功能模块获取集成第三方系统的信息,进一步提高了消息通信的集成化。
[0007]优选的,所述接入并获取第三方系统用户的数据参数,将所述数据参数录入至用户信息数据库并与用户信息数据库内预存的用户信息数据进行匹配具体包括:基于应用接入引擎接入第三方系统的数据开放接口;
读取并存储第三方系统用户的身份数据;将信息数据录入至用户信息数据库中;基于相关算法将所述身份数据与用户信息数据进行匹配并输出匹配结果数据。
[0008]通过采用上述技术方案,应用接入引擎与第三方系统的数据开放接口接通,对用户的身份系统读取并存储,再通过算法将身份数据与用户信息数据进行匹配并输出匹配结果数据,提高了用户身份数据匹配的准确性。
[0009]优选的,调用并封装第三方系统的原生接口具体包括:读取第三方系统的原生接口,所述原生接口包括定位接口、拍照接口、扫码接口、消息接口等;对所述原生接口统一进行定义和封装。
[0010]通过采用上述技术方案,对第三方系统的定位接口、拍照接口、扫码接口、消息接口等进行封装,便于对原生接口的调用处理。
[0011]优选的,获取企业应用集成平台内的应用构件,并将应用构件发布至第三方系统中具体包括:基于应用集成接入引擎获取企业应用集成平台内的HTML5应用构件;将HTML5应用构件与第三方现有的HTML5应用进行整合;将整合后的HTML5应用构件发送至第三方系统中。
[0012]通过采用上述技术方案,便于企业自身研发的HTML5应用调用,同时便于帮助企业实现一次开发多处发布。
[0013]优选的,利用第三方系统的原生接口和所述应用构件组建移动端应用功能模块具体包括:将发送至第三方系统中的HTML5应用构件与第三方系统的原生接口进行整合;组建移动端应用功能模块。
[0014]通过采用上述技术方案,将发送至第三方系统中的HTML5应用构件与第三方系统的原生接口进行整合,便于移动端应用功能模块的组建。
[0015]优选的,所述移动端应用功能模块包括移动门户单元、移动考勤单元、外勤管理单元、名片管理单元、工资单元等。
[0016]通过采用上述技术方案,移动端应用模块由多功能单元集成而成,提高了移动端应用功能模块的功能性。
[0017]优选的,基于移动端应用功能模块获取集成第三方系统的消息并发送具体包括:利用第三方系统的消息推送机制、即时沟通API获取移动端应用模块的消息;进行实时消息推送及即时沟通需求推送。
[0018]第二方面,本申请提供的应用于第三方系统与用户端之间的数据通信系统采用如下的技术方案:应用于第三方系统与用户端之间的数据通信系统包括:集成接入模块,配置为与移动应用前端入口连接,获取移动应用前端的类别和用户注册信息;用户认证模块,配置为获取所述用户注册信息,将所述用户注册信息与用户信息库内的信息数据匹配后输出用户认证信息;
APP组件调用模块,用于封装所述移动应用前端的原生接口;应用发布管理模块,配置为与服务器内HTML5模块集成管理;消息推送管理模块,用于接收用户端发出的消息指令,将所述消息指令发送至移动应用前端的消息推送;安全控制管理模块,用于对用户认证信息和用户注册信息进行安全管理。
[0019]通过采用上述技术方案,能够为不同用户群体构建不同的移动应用入口,更具不同的客户选择不同的第三方系统作为移动化基础入口,并且能够利用第三方系统的原生特性接口能力,例如:拍照、扫码、定位、即时消息、通讯,通过HTML5技术结合第三方系统的成熟原生接口构建移动端应用功能,实现消息数据同步与数据通讯。
[0020]第三方面,本申请提供的应用于第三方系统与用户端之间的数据通信方法采用如下的技术方案:应用于第三方系统与用户端之间的数据通信装置,包括数据通信中间件。
[0021]通过采用上述技术方案,中间件能够应对快速增长的移动端需求,移动应用服务的对象多,为了满足不同对象的移动端诉求,满足企业一点应用多点发布的移动端诉求,减少信息孤岛的情况发生。
[0022]第四方面,本申请提供的应用于第三方系统与用户端之间的数据通信存储介质采用如下的技术方案:应用于第三方系统与用户端之间的数据通信存储介质,存储有能够被处理器加载并执行上述任一项所述方法的计算机程序。
[0023]通过采用上述技术方案,由计算机程序控制整个方法的运行,有助于提高整个方法运行的稳定性和精确性。
[0024]综上所述,本申请包括以下至少一种有益技术效果:1.获取第三方系统的用户信息并进行匹配判断用户信息的安全,以提高用户信息的安全性,并通过第三方系统的远程接口和应用构件共同组建移动端应用功能模块,提高了数据通信的快捷性和稳定性,并基于移动端应用功能模块获取集成第三方系统的信息,进一步提高了消息通信的集成化;2.能够为不同用户群体构建不同的移动应用入口,更具不同的客户选择不同的第三方系统作为移动化基础入口,并且能够利用第三方系统的原生特性接口能力,例如:拍照、扫码、定位、即时消息、通讯,通本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.应用于第三方系统与用户端之间的数据通信方法,其特征在于,包括以下步骤:接入并获取第三方系统用户的数据参数,将所述数据参数录入至用户信息数据库并与用户信息数据库内预存的用户信息数据进行匹配;基于安全平台检测第三方系统用户的数据参数安全性;调用并封装第三方系统的原生接口;获取企业应用集成平台内的应用构件,并将应用构件发布至第三方系统中;利用第三方系统的原生接口和所述应用构件组建移动端应用功能模块;基于移动端应用功能模块获取、集成第三方系统的消息并发送。2.根据权利要求1所述的应用于第三方系统与用户端之间的数据通信方法,其特征在于,所述接入并获取第三方系统用户的数据参数,将所述数据参数录入至用户信息数据库并与用户信息数据库内预存的用户信息数据进行匹配具体包括:基于应用接入引擎接入第三方系统的数据开放接口;读取并存储第三方系统用户的身份数据;将信息数据录入至用户信息数据库中;基于相关算法将所述身份数据与用户信息数据进行匹配并输出匹配结果数据。3.权利要求1所述的应用于第三方系统与用户端之间的数据通信方法,其特征在于,调用并封装第三方系统的原生接口具体包括:读取第三方系统的原生接口,所述原生接口包括定位接口、拍照接口、扫码接口、消息接口等;对所述原生接口统一进行定义和封装。4.根据权利要求1所述的应用于第三方系统与用户端之间的数据通信方法,其特征在于,获取企业应用集成平台内的应用构件,并将应用构件发布至第三方系统中具体包括:基于应用集成接入引擎获取企业应用集成平台内的HTML5应用构件;将HTML5应用构件与第三方现有的HTML5应用进行整合;将整合后的HTML5应用构件发送至第三方系统中。5.根据权利要求1所述的应用于第三...

【专利技术属性】
技术研发人员:林敏何文邢星王婷
申请(专利权)人:毕埃慕上海建筑数据技术股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1